In 1905, there was no federally mandated minimum wage in the United States. The concept of a minimum wage did not emerge until the 20th century, with the first state-level minimum wage laws being enacted in the 1910s. Labor conditions during this time varied widely, and wages were often determined by the market and local conditions rather than any legal standard.

The California minimum wage increased by 50 cents an hour starting in 2018, rising to $10.50 an hour for small employers and to $11.00 an hour for large employers. This is the first step in a multi-year plan to boost the minimum wage for all workers. There are several jobs that the minimum wage law does not cover.
